  Discourse particles and belief reasoning: The case of German "doch"

Schmerse, D., Lieven, E. V. M., & Tomasello, M. (2014). Discourse particles and belief reasoning: The case of German "doch". Journal of Semantics, 31(1), 115-133. doi:10.1093/jos/fft001.
